How to Turn Your Marriage Relationship Around Before the Weekend!

Navigating challenges in a marriage is normal, but it’s essential to address issues before they escalate. Turning your relationship around requires proactive steps and a commitment to positive change.

2. Assess Your Current Situation

Take a moment to reflect on the current state of your marriage. Identify any recurring issues or areas of discontent. Understanding the root causes of your problems is the first step towards resolution.

2.1 Reflecting on the State of the Marriage

Consider the overall health of your relationship. Are you and your partner communicating effectively? Are there unresolved conflicts or unmet needs?

2.2 Identifying Key Issues

Pinpoint specific areas of concern, such as lack of communication, trust issues, or emotional distance. Acknowledging these challenges is crucial for progress.

3. Open Communication

Communication is the cornerstone of a healthy marriage. Create a safe space for open and honest dialogue with your partner.

3.1 Techniques for Effective Communication

Practice active listening and empathy. Avoid blame or criticism, and focus on expressing your feelings and needs constructively.

6. Addressing Conflict

Conflict is inevitable in any relationship, but it’s how you handle it that matters. Approach disagreements with patience and a willingness to compromise.

6.1 Strategies for Resolving Conflicts

Practice active listening and seek to understand your partner’s perspective. Look for common ground and work together towards a resolution.

7. Seek Professional Help

Don’t hesitate to seek outside assistance if needed. Marriage counseling or therapy can provide valuable guidance and support.

7.1 Options for Counseling or Therapy

Consider couples therapy or individual counseling to address deeper issues within the relationship. A trained professional can offer impartial guidance and facilitate productive conversations.
